rocketmq怎么保证消息不丢
RocketMQ提供了多种方式来保证消息不丢失:同步刷盘:在消息发送时,可以选择同步刷盘模式,即消息发送成功后,会等待消息写入磁
0评论2025-02-15892
docker重启后数据丢失怎么恢复
如果在Docker重启后发生数据丢失,以下是一些可能的解决方案:检查数据卷:首先,确保你的数据是存储在Docker数据卷中而不是容器
0评论2025-02-15981
mongodb怎么每天备份数据库
要每天备份MongoDB数据库,可以使用以下方法:使用mongodump命令自动备份:创建一个备份脚本,并使用mongodump命令来备份数据库
0评论2025-02-15688
java redis集群怎么配置
要配置Java Redis集群,你需要执行以下步骤:首先,确保你已经安装了Redis并且启动了Redis服务器。在Java项目中,你需要添加Redi
0评论2025-02-15385
linux ftp服务怎么搭建
要搭建Linux FTP服务,你需要按照以下步骤进行操作:安装FTP服务器软件。常见的FTP服务器软件有vsftpd、ProFTPD和Pure-FTPd等。
0评论2025-02-15700
rocketmq主从同步的原理是什么
RocketMQ主从同步的原理是通过将消息发送到主节点后,主节点将消息写入磁盘,并将消息同步给从节点。从节点在接收到主节点的消息
0评论2025-02-15334
redis延时双删代码怎么写
在Redis中实现延时双删的代码可以使用Lua脚本来完成。下面是一个示例:local key = KEYS[1]local timestamp = tonumber(ARGV[1])
0评论2025-02-15560
kafka防止消息丢失的方法是什么
Kafka 通过以下方法来防止消息丢失:持久化:Kafka使用持久化的方式将消息写入磁盘,这样即使发生故障或重启,数据仍然可用。复
0评论2025-02-15831
java如何将日期转成年月日
在Java中,可以使用SimpleDateFormat类来将日期转换为年月日格式。下面是一个简单的示例代码:import java.text.SimpleDateForma
0评论2025-02-15566
redis主要存放的数据类型有哪些
Redis主要存放的数据类型有以下几种:String(字符串):可以存储字符串、整数或浮点数。Hash(哈希):由field(字段)和value
0评论2025-02-15473
c++标识符如何定义
在C++中,标识符是用来表示变量、函数、类、对象等的名称。以下是关于C++标识符的定义规则:标识符由字母、数字和下划线组成。标
0评论2025-02-15691
MySQL热点数据怎么处理
处理MySQL热点数据可以采取以下几种方法:分库分表:将热点数据分散到不同的数据库或表中,避免单个数据库或表的负载过高。可以
0评论2025-02-15399
c语言怎么获取当前文件路径
在C语言中,可以使用标准库中的__FILE__宏来获取当前文件的路径。这个宏会返回一个字符串,表示当前文件的路径。以下是一个简单
0评论2025-02-15688
java抽象类和接口的异同点是什么
Java中的抽象类和接口都是用于实现面向对象编程的重要概念,它们具有一些相似之处,也有一些不同之处。相同点:都不能被实例化:
0评论2025-02-15842
redis怎么保证热点数据
要保证Redis中的热点数据,可以采取以下几种策略:淘汰策略:通过设置适当的淘汰策略来保留热点数据。Redis有多种淘汰策略可供选
0评论2025-02-15571
c++抽象类怎么定义和使用
在C++中,抽象类是一种特殊的类,不能被实例化,只能被用作其他类的基类。抽象类通常用于定义一组相关的方法的接口,而不提供具
0评论2025-02-15460
redis本地服务器连接不上怎么解决
如果你无法连接到本地的Redis服务器,可能是由于以下几个原因引起的:Redis服务器未启动:请确保Redis服务器已经正确安装并且已
0评论2025-02-15385
c语言怎么创建文件并写入数据
要在C语言中创建文件并写入数据,您可以使用文件指针和相关的文件处理函数来完成。下面是一个简单的示例:#include stdio.hint m
0评论2025-02-15630
vc怎么获取exe所在路径
在VC++中,可以使用GetModuleFileName函数来获取exe所在的路径。示例代码如下:#include iostream#include windows.hint main(){
0评论2025-02-15737
delphi中pos函数的用法是什么
在Delphi中,Pos函数用于查找子字符串在给定字符串中的起始位置。其语法如下:function Pos(const SubStr: string; const Str: s
0评论2025-02-15299
redis突然连不上的原因有哪些
有以下几个可能的原因导致Redis突然无法连接:Redis服务器未运行:如果Redis服务器未启动,则无法连接。可以通过运行redis-serve
0评论2025-02-15405
redis热点数据怎么更新
更新 Redis 热点数据可以通过以下几种方式:直接更新:直接使用 Redis 提供的 SET 命令更新热点数据的值。例如:SET key value。
0评论2025-02-15364
C++派生类的定义是什么
C++派生类的定义是通过继承已有的基类(也称为父类或超类)来创建一个新的类。派生类会继承基类的成员变量和成员函数,并且可以
0评论2025-02-15681
linux如何删除vim创建的文件
要删除由Vim创建的文件,您可以使用以下步骤:打开终端并导航到包含要删除文件的目录。确保文件不在使用中,如果正在使用,请关
0评论2025-02-15805
python怎么调用so文件
在Python中调用.so文件的一种常见方法是使用ctypes库。导入ctypes库:import ctypes加载.so文件:so_file = ctypes.CDLL(path/to
0评论2025-02-15314
linux中java怎么调用动态库
在Linux中,Java可以通过JNI(Java Native Interface)调用动态库。以下是一些步骤:编写本地接口类:创建一个Java类,其中声明
0评论2025-02-15534
ubuntu中vim删除内容的方法是什么
在Ubuntu中,使用vim删除内容的方法有两种:使用dd命令:在vim编辑器中,将光标定位到要删除的行上,然后按下dd命令,即可删除当
0评论2025-02-15541
c语言怎么读取文件内容
在C语言中,可以使用fopen()函数打开一个文件,然后使用fscanf()或fgets()函数来读取文件内容。以下是一个示例代码:#include st
0评论2025-02-15323
redis数据清除的策略是什么
Redis 的数据清除策略主要有三种:LRU(Least Recently Used,最近最少使用)、LFU(Least Frequently Used,最不经常使用)和淘
0评论2025-02-15734
c++无法读取内存怎么解决
如果C++无法读取内存,可能是由于以下原因:内存访问越界:检查代码中是否有访问数组或指针时超出其范围的情况。确保在访问数组
0评论2025-02-15956
redis连接数过多如处理
当Redis连接数过多时,可以考虑以下几种处理方法:增加Redis实例:可以通过增加Redis实例的数量来分担连接负载,将连接分散到多
0评论2025-02-15938
redis怎么限制ip访问次数
要限制Redis的IP访问次数,可以使用Redis的INCR命令结合EXPIRE命令和Lua脚本来实现。首先,创建一个Lua脚本来实现IP访问次数限制
0评论2025-02-15903
c语言怎么定义bool变量
在C语言中,bool变量没有内置的类型,需要通过宏定义来创建一个bool类型。可以使用以下代码来定义bool变量:#include stdbool.hi
0评论2025-02-15652
c语言char和int的区别是什么
C语言中的char和int是两种不同的数据类型,它们的区别主要体现在以下几个方面:内存占用:char类型占用一个字节(8位),而int类
0评论2025-02-15579
mongodb怎么配置用户名和密码
要在MongoDB中配置用户名和密码,你需要进行以下几个步骤:启动MongoDB实例时,需要开启身份验证功能。你可以通过在命令行中使用
0评论2025-02-15336
MySQL标识符无效如何解决
当MySQL报告标识符无效错误时,可能有几个原因。以下是解决此问题的一些常见方法:检查标识符名称是否正确:确保你使用的所有表
0评论2025-02-15920
怎么连接远程的mongodb
你可以使用MongoDB提供的官方驱动程序来连接远程的MongoDB数据库。以下是使用Node.js驱动程序的示例:首先,确保你已经安装了Nod
0评论2025-02-15992
java中scanner的用法有哪些
Scanner是Java标准库提供的一个用于读取用户输入的类,可以用来读取不同类型的数据,如整数、浮点数、字符串等。下面是一些常用
0评论2025-02-15997
mongodb怎么添加管理员账号
要添加MongoDB的管理员账号,可以按照以下步骤进行操作:连接到MongoDB服务器:mongo切换到admin数据库:use admin创建一个管理
0评论2025-02-15204
c++内存分配失败怎么解决
当C++的内存分配失败时,可能是由于以下几个原因:内存不足:系统的内存资源已经耗尽,无法分配更多的内存。这时候可以尝试释放
0评论2025-02-15372
c语言bool类型如何输入
在C语言中,bool类型并不是原生支持的数据类型,但可以使用stdbool.h头文件来定义bool类型。在该头文件中,bool类型被定义为一个
0评论2025-02-15497
java中textfield怎么应用
在Java中,可以使用TextField类来创建和使用文本输入框(TextField)。以下是一个简单的示例,演示如何在Java中应用TextField:i
0评论2025-02-15483
python如何定义空集合
在Python中,可以使用两种方式来定义空集合:使用set()函数:可以通过调用set()函数来创建一个空集合。例如:my_set = set()使用
0评论2025-02-15775
linux开机自启动程序怎么设置
在Linux系统中,可以通过编辑特定文件来设置开机自启动程序。打开终端。使用root用户或者以root权限运行终端命令。找到要设置开
0评论2025-02-15859
python中怎么将元组改为列表
要将元组转换为列表,可以使用内置函数list()。将元组作为参数传递给list()函数即可完成转换。下面是一个示例代码:tuple1 = (1,
0评论2025-02-15814
mongodb怎么用游标更新数据库
在mongodb中,你可以使用游标(Cursor)来更新数据库。下面是一个使用游标更新数据库的示例代码:// 导入mongodb驱动程序const {
0评论2025-02-15881
delphi的ListView分页显示怎么实现
要实现Delphi的ListView分页显示,可以按照以下步骤进行操作:在Delphi的窗体上放置一个ListView控件,用于显示数据。设置ListVi
0评论2025-02-15652
mysql索引的原理是什么
MySQL索引的原理是基于B树或B+树的数据结构来实现的。B树是一种平衡的多路搜索树,用于存储和管理有序的数据。B树的每一个节点可
0评论2025-02-15427
python restful框架有什么作用
Python的RESTful框架是用来开发和构建基于REST架构风格的Web服务的工具。它的主要作用包括:简化开发:RESTful框架提供了一系列
0评论2025-02-15229
C#中panel滚动条怎么实现
在C#中,要实现panel的滚动条,可以使用VScrollBar和HScrollBar控件。首先在窗体上添加一个panel控件,并将其AutoScroll属性设置
0评论2025-02-15457
python判断空值的方法是什么
在Python中,可以使用以下方法来判断一个值是否为空:使用if语句判断:使用if语句可以检查一个值是否为None,例如:value = None
0评论2025-02-15658
python如何修改列表数据
要修改Python列表中的数据,可以使用索引值来访问并修改特定位置的元素。可以通过以下步骤来修改列表数据:使用索引值访问要修改
0评论2025-02-15333
mysql source命令导入报错怎么解决
当使用MySQL的source命令导入数据时,可能会遇到一些错误。以下是一些常见的错误及其解决方法:ERROR 1044 (42000): Access deni
0评论2025-02-15715
java怎么判断空值和null值
在Java中,可以使用以下方法来判断一个值是空值(空字符串)还是null值:对于字符串类型,可以使用.isEmpty()方法来判断一个字符
0评论2025-02-15208
mysql删除元组的方法是什么
在 MySQL 中,要删除元组(也称为行)的方法是使用 DELETE 语句。以下是删除元组的基本语法:DELETE FROM 表名WHERE 条
0评论2025-02-15896
python触发器使用异常怎么解决
在Python中,处理异常可以使用try-except语句块来捕获和处理异常。当触发器使用过程中出现异常时,可以在try块中执行相关代码,
0评论2025-02-15864
mac安装mongodb的步骤是什么
安装 MongoDB 的步骤如下:在 MongoDB 的官方网站(https://www.mongodb.com/)下载适用于 macOS 的 MongoDB Community Server
0评论2025-02-15964
python怎么创建一个空字典
在Python中,可以使用空的大括号或者dict()函数来创建一个空字典。具体示例如下:方法一:使用大括号创建空字典my_dict = {}prin
0评论2025-02-15391
java中getsource的用法是什么
在Java中,getSource()方法是在事件处理中常用的方法之一。它是从事件对象中获取事件源(即触发事件的对象)的方法。当一个事件
0评论2025-02-15339
数据库元组的概念是什么
数据库元组是数据库中的基本数据单元,也被称为记录或行。它是一个包含一组相关数据项的集合,可以看作是一个实体或对象的表示。
0评论2025-02-15507
mongodb中怎么修改账户密码
要修改MongoDB中的账户密码,可以使用以下命令:打开MongoDB的命令行窗口。使用管理员账户登录到MongoDB。mongouse admindb.auth
0评论2025-02-15555